jgb9348 (11828) reviewed Double Doobious from Bad Sons Beer Company 2 years ago
Appearance - 8 | Aroma - 8 | Flavor - 7 | Texture - 8 | Overall - 7.5
Very hazy orange and even bronze coloured body with a large, four centimetre tall off-white and tan head that stays afloat nicely. Aroma of oranges, grass, hay, flowers and some relatively pungent yeast with some alcohol noticeable in the nose, too. Medium to Full-bodied; Fairly resinous flavours up front with oranges and grapefruit here, as well as big malt notes and again, some of the alcohol here is noticeable and fairly astringent. Aftertaste shows some drying notes with flowers, grassy and hay very noticeable, but the orange, citrus, resin and sweet flavours finish this off nicely, with a big robust quality that feels of Imperial Status. Overall, a nice, resinous, robust and flavourful real-ish Imperial IPA that has a nice complexity that is somehow relatively sweet and still bitter. Nice to sample this from Connecticut and I'll be trying to find others from this brewery in the near future when I'm back in Connecticut. I sampled this sixteen ounce, pint-sized can, purchased from GlenRo Spirit Shoppe in Monroe, Connecticut on 19-December-2021 for US$3,49 with the tagline 'double the pleasure' and '95/95' on the bottom of the can, sampled at my house here in Washington on 12-May-2022.
